WebMar 15, 2024 · The Most Common Types of Vinyl Record There are four core types of vinyl records that you’re most likely to come across today. 12 Inch LP (Long-playing) Albums. Introduced in 1948, LP albums were a huge improvement on the existing shellac 78 records that were very brittle and limited to less than five minutes of playback per side. WebJan 2, 2024 · Completing the Shellac Finish. After the first coat of shellac completely dries, lightly sand the surface with 400-grit sandpaper. Wipe off the white residue with a soft tack cloth, and apply a second coat. Repeat the process until you've applied the desired number of coats. Shellac is a … WebThe Melting Process produces Wax-Containing Shellac (sometimes called Orange Shellac) and was traditionally handmade, but apart from Button Lac, is now largely machine-made. This type of Shellac is extracted from the Seedlac by melting it using steam heat and then squeezing the molten Lac through a fine metal filter using hydraulic presses.

WebJun 12, 2024 · Shellac: Shellac is a clear finish product which provides a substrate with moderate water protection and effective protection against solvents. Some shellac type is yellowish tint. The coating is durable which does not require reapplication. Shellacs are compatible with other coatings and acts as an effective base layer. Shellac in its acid form undergoes aging, resulting in the change of its physicochemical properties. Therefore, various shellac types were investigated as free films prepared from ammoniacal solutions and as micronized powder in its acid form. Due to its acidic character, shellac shows a pH-dependent solubility. maple grove friends of the library
